Python的 7 种日期和星期转换方法
以下将围绕2022年9月18日这一日期,介绍Python中获取指定日期星期几的6种方法。第1种方法是使用`dateutil.parser`模块。这个模块能够解析多种日期时间格式,兼容性较好。安装方式为:`sudo pip install dateutil==2.0`。它的优势在于能够处理各种日期格式,提供时区支持,易于将字符串转换为日期时间对象。
Python语言基础(7.4)calendar模块
打印一年的日历:calendar.prcal(年份, 月份, 星期)打印一个月的日历:calendar.prmonth(年份, 月份, 星期)闰年计算与日历分析对于闰年的判断,使用calendar.isleap(年份),而计算两个年份之间的闰年数量,可以使用calendar.leapdays(开始年份, 结束年份)。日期辅助功能获取某月第一天是星期几和总天数:ca...
Python Calendar:掌握日历模块的秘籍
首先,让我们通过import calendar语句导入这个模块。calendar模块的核心功能包括:生成并格式化指定年份的日历,如使用`TextCalendar.formatyear(year)`方法。获取指定月份的日历,`TextCalendar.formatmonth(year, month)`方法能提供详细信息。利用`calendar.monthrange(year, month)`函数,获取指定年月的天数及其...
python专题calendar模块
calendar模块的核心功能包括:firstweekday()函数返回默认每周开始的日期值,可通过setfirstweekday()设置为MONDAY到SUNDAY中的任意一天。isleap()和leapdays()用于判断年份是否为闰年,以及计算指定区间内的闰年数量。weekday()方法能获取指定日期是星期几,monthrange()则提供给定月份第一天是星期几和月天数。
calendar -- 日历相关│Python标准库
常见用于查看。HTMLCalendar 类生成网页展示的日历,提供修改标签样式的能力。快捷函数和类方法包括 setfirstweekday()、isleap()、leapdays()、weekday() 等。使用 Python 代码生成的日历可与 CSS 结合,以美观地展示。模块文档和源代码可为开发者提供深入理解与应用的资源。
python 界面编程之PyQt6---入门篇---日期与时间
在日期和时间处理上,PyQt6提供了QDate,QDateTime和QTime类,它们为应用程序提供了强大的日期时间管理功能。例如,通过daysInMonth方法,开发者可以轻松获取指定月份的天数,这对于处理日历相关逻辑非常实用;而daysInYear方法则可以获取指定年份的总天数,这对于计算周期性事件的发生频率很有帮助。时间的计算...
Python中各模块完整介绍-CFTA注册金融科技分析师一级考点
时间与日期功能模块`calendar`运用`calendar`模块中的`month`函数,可以获取特定年月的日历。此模块的函数主要与日历相关,如打印某月的字符月历。通过设置`calendar.setfirstweekday()`函数,可以更改每周的第一天,默认为星期一,最后一天为星期天。时间模块`time``time`模块通过相关函数操作可以获取当前...
python时间处理之calendar模块
l是每星期的行数。print(calendar.month(2021,12,w=2,l=1)) result:%&&&&&%print(calendar.month(2021,12,w=2,l=1))9 1.print(calendar.month(2021,12,w=2,l=1))9 prcal()方法 相当于print(calendar.calendar())calendar.prcal(2021,w=2,l=1,c=6) result:2021JanuaryFebruaryMarchMoTuWeThFrS...
python怎么获取连续多少个日期(python怎么获取连续多少个日期的数据...
使用time模块的time.localtime()获取当前日期,使用calendar模块calendar.monthrange的来获取指定月份的天数。即可得到月初日期和月末日期,代码如下:importcalendarimporttimeday_now=time.localtime()day_begin='%d-%02d-01'%python如何只获取日期 这里我们要用到的是python的内置模块,time模块。 顾名思义,这是一个和时...
calendarnow1=calendar.getinstance()是什么意思
在Python编程中,`calendar`模块提供了一系列用于处理日历相关的功能。当你想要进行与日期有关的一些计算或操作时,这个模块会非常有用。例如,你可以使用它来计算某个月的天数,或者获取特定日期的星期几等。在这行代码中:`calendar` 是Python内置的日历模块。`getinstance` 是该模块中的一个方法,用于...